Jalandhar, September 26, 2013:  Varun Roojam, Deputy Commissioner, Jalandhar today warned that Punjab Government would be forced to initiate punitive action against all those illegal colonies that fail to get themselves regularised before the last date of regularisation (October 7, 2013).
Presiding over a meeting to review the progress of regularization of illegal colonies in the district, the Deputy Commissioner said that the District Administration was extending all possible cooperation to individual residents and colonizers in getting their forms filled in different camps organised in various colonies so that most of the people could avail this last opportunity.
He said that people should come forward to avail this opportunity and warned that there would not be any extension of last date as the policy has been finalised by the Punjab cabinet.  
Roojam said that after 7th October the district administration would launch punitive action against residents, plot holders, developers and promoters under PAPR Act 1995 under which FIR would be lodged against guilty that would also result in disconnection of power and water connection. He clarified that after October 7, 2013 no more illegal colony would be regularised and it may result in demolition of illegal structures.
The Deputy Commissioner asked all concerned officers to launch the campaign of regularisation of illegal colonies in a coordinated manner so that there was no difficulty faced by the applicants.
